About Charfield Green

Charfield Green unfolds as a thoughtful cluster of dwellings in Gloucestershire's embrace. It lies 3.3 km west-south-west of Wotton-under-Edge (from Wotton-under-Edge: bearing 254°T, OS grid ST 725 923), and is situated east-north-east of Charfield village.
